WebStorm配置使用SVN(从服务端到客户端)

时间:2024-03-25 21:22:42

令人脑阔疼的一次安装体验!

一、下载安装软件

先把需要用到的软件全部下载安装完成

1.node.js : https://nodejs.org/en/download/

WebStorm配置使用SVN(从服务端到客户端)

2.SlikSvn : https://sliksvn.com/download/

 

WebStorm配置使用SVN(从服务端到客户端)

安装过程需要注意的是,默认安装没有选择”command line client tools”,这里需要选上。 

WebStorm配置使用SVN(从服务端到客户端)

记住此时安装的目录,后面配置WebStorm将会用到

3.SVN服务器 VisualSVN : https://www.visualsvn.com/server/download/

WebStorm配置使用SVN(从服务端到客户端)

二、配置VisualSVN

在VisualSVN创建项目svntest,创建用户

(1)创建项目svntest

在Repositories上右键,选择Create New Repository...,然后按照要求点击下一步即可;

WebStorm配置使用SVN(从服务端到客户端)

WebStorm配置使用SVN(从服务端到客户端)

WebStorm配置使用SVN(从服务端到客户端)

WebStorm配置使用SVN(从服务端到客户端)

WebStorm配置使用SVN(从服务端到客户端)

WebStorm配置使用SVN(从服务端到客户端)

创建项目成功后如上图所示,会提示 Repository Created Successfully,name : svntest、URL:http://dell-pc/svn/svntest

URL地址要记住,后面将会用到

WebStorm配置使用SVN(从服务端到客户端)

创建完成后如上图所示,其中的 .idea 和 index.html 是后期导入的,刚创建完是没有的

(2)创建用户

在Users上右键,选择Create User...,此时会弹出窗口要求输入用户名和密码

WebStorm配置使用SVN(从服务端到客户端)       WebStorm配置使用SVN(从服务端到客户端)

输入用户名和密码后点击OK,记住此时的用户名和密码,配置 WebStorm 将会用到

创建成功后如下图所示

WebStorm配置使用SVN(从服务端到客户端)

三、配置WebStorm

(1)打开WebStorm,菜单中选择“文件>> 设置...”; 

WebStorm配置使用SVN(从服务端到客户端)

(2)单击“Plugins”,单击“Browse repositories...”按钮;

WebStorm配置使用SVN(从服务端到客户端)

(3)搜索“svn”,然后在搜索结果中点击“SVNToolBox”,单击“Install”按钮;

WebStorm配置使用SVN(从服务端到客户端)

(4)安装完毕后“重新启动WebStorm”;

WebStorm配置使用SVN(从服务端到客户端)

(5)正确安装后,再次进入Webstorm,选择“文件>> 设置… >> Version Control”,便可以看到这里多了 Subversion的设置项;

将 Subversion 设置项中的第一个空白路径设置为 SilkSvn 的安装路径,然后点击下面的确定即可,这样 WebStorm 配置完毕。

WebStorm配置使用SVN(从服务端到客户端)

 四、从Svn上面拉项目

(1)打开 WebStorm 然后点击 VCS,找到从版本控制中检出,然后点击 Subversion,此时会出现 Checkout from Subversion 弹窗;

WebStorm配置使用SVN(从服务端到客户端)

(2)点击弹窗上的 + 号,把刚刚在 VisualSVN 上创建的 svntest 项目的地址写上并点击确定;接下来会弹出弹窗输入用户名和密码,将创建用户的用户名和密码输入即可;

WebStorm配置使用SVN(从服务端到客户端)WebStorm配置使用SVN(从服务端到客户端)

(3)回到 Checkout from Subversion 页面,选择 svntest 并点击 checkout ,在弹窗中选择要进行版本控制的项目依次选择确定

WebStorm配置使用SVN(从服务端到客户端)WebStorm配置使用SVN(从服务端到客户端)WebStorm配置使用SVN(从服务端到客户端)

(4)开启版本控制,将当前项目Import到SVN上,团队的其他成员可以连接你的SVN服务器进行代码编写,提交。

每次更改完代码后先更新再上传即可!

WebStorm配置使用SVN(从服务端到客户端)

WebStorm配置使用SVN(从服务端到客户端)